Utagawa Hiroshige 歌川広重

Mino Promontory, Bungo Province, Edo (Japanese period)

Maker

  • Utagawa Hiroshige 歌川広重
  • Yoshimuraya Heisuke

Title

Mino Promontory, Bungo Province

Year

Edo (Japanese period)

Medium

ink, color

Materials/Techniques

Materials

  • Polychrome wood block print

Techniques

  • Polychrome wood block print

Supports

  • paper

Dimensions

Plate: 33 x 22.7 cm (13 x 8 15/16 inches) (Mat size: D)

Signature / Inscription / Marks

Signature: Hiroshige hitsu

Seals: Publisher's seal | Koshihei; censor's seal | aratame | 1856, 12th month

Place

Place Made: Japan; Place Made: Tokyo

Type

  • Prints

Credit

Gift of Marshall H. Gould

Object Number

46.294.8
